www.newsnow.comMarseille reclaimed third place in the French Ligue 1 table with a 3-1 win over bottom side Metz on Friday to boost their hopes of Champions League qualification, while Monaco's long unbeaten run ended in a shock 4-1 defeat away to Paris FC.Pierre-Emerick Aubameyang gave Marseille a first-half lead at the Velodrome, and Igor Paixao latched onto a superb Mason Greenwood pass to make it 2-0 early in the second half.Giorgi Tsitaishvili pulled one back for Metz, who are now 17 league games without...
www.thescore.comFrench giants Marseille suffered a Ligue 1 first-day upset when felled 1-0 by 10-man Rennes on Friday.The opening game of the 2025/26 season was heading for a goalless stalemate until Ludovic Blas secured the injury-time winner, six minutes after entering the fray.Home side Rennes went down a man in the 31st minute with the sending off of Moroccan teenager Abdelhamid Ait Boudlal for a foul on Michael Murillo.Marseille will be kicking themselves after hitting the post twice via Adrien Rabiot...
